Robert dennis crumb born august 30, 1943 is an american artist, illustrator, and musician recognized for the distinctive style of his drawings and his critical, satirical, subversive view of the american mainstream. Robert crumb was born 30 august 1943 in philadelphia to a catholic household of english and scottish descent, spending his early years in west philadelphia and upper darby. This sixbook boxed set is the first collection of robert crumb sketches to be printed from the original art since the hardbound, slipcased, seven volume series issued by the german publisher zweitausendeins between 1981 and 1997.
